WebJan 7, 2024 · Look for: Small red bumps. Where: Around the base of hairs that have been shaved away. Cause: Friction and irritation from a razor; the tips of curly hairs can also pierce the skin, becoming ingrown. Home care: Gently scrubbing with a washcloth before shaving to remove dead skin may help. WebJun 21, 2024 · common skin growth that can be found anywhere on the body but is most likely to be seen on the torso, arms, legs, and shoulders more common in people over age … WebKeratosis pilaris is a common condition where small bumps develop on your skin, especially your arms, legs or butt. Excess keratin in your skin causes bumps to form. This condition is harmless and typically doesn’t need treatment, and usually fades by age 30.
